Télécharger Imprimer la page

Aim TTi TGA12100 Serie Manuel D'instructions page 91

Publicité

Création et effacement d'onde arbitraire
NOTE : Avant d'utiliser les commandes de ce paragraphe, prendre la précaution de vérifier que
toutes les voies de l'instrument génèrent en mode continu. Des résultats inattendus risqueraient
de se produire.
ARBDELETE <cpd>
ARBCREATE <cpd>,<nrf>
ARBDEFCSV
<cpd>,<nrf>,<csv ascii data>
ARBDEF
<cpd>,<nrf>,<bin data block>
90
Efface l'onde arbitraire <cpd> de la carte mémoire.
Crée une nouvelle forme d'onde arbitraire vide nommée
<cpd> et d'une longueur de <nrf> points.
Permet de définir une forme d'onde arbitraire nouvelle ou
existante de nom <cpd> et d'une longueur <nrf>, et de
charger les données contenues dans <cv ascii data>. Si la
forme d'onde arbitraire n'existe pas, ce procédé la créée. Si
elle existe, la longueur est vérifiée par rapport à celle qui a
été définie, un avertissement est émis si elles sont
différentes. Les limites d'édition doivent être réglées sur les
extrémités de la forme d'onde. Les données consistent en
valeurs codées en ascii dans la fourchette -2048 à +2047
pour chacun des points. Les valeurs sont séparées par un
caractère virgule et les données se terminent par <pmt>. Si
les données envoyées sont inférieures au nombre de points
de la forme d'onde, les anciennes données sont conservées
à partir du point où se terminent les nouvelles données. S'il y
a un excès de données, les données supplémentaires sont
ignorées.
Permet de définir une forme d'onde arbitraire nouvelle ou
existante avec le nom <cpd> et une longueur <nfr>, et de
charger les données contenues dans <bin data block>. Si la
forme d'onde arbitraire n'existe pas, elle est créée. Si elle
existe, la longueur est comparée à celle qui a été définie et
un avertissement est émis si elles sont différentes. Les
limites d'édition doivent être réglées sur les extrémités de la
forme d'onde. Les données se présentent en deux octets par
point sans caractère entre les octets ou les points. L'octet
supérieur des points des données est envoyé d'abord. Le
bloc de données a en en-tête le caractère # suivi par
plusieurs caractères numériques codés en ascii. Le premier
de ces caractères définit le nombre de caractères ascii qui le
suivent et ces caractères qui le suivent définissent à leur tour
la longueur des données binaires en octets. Si on envoie un
nombre de données inférieur au nombre de points entre les
limites, les données précédentes sont conservées à partir du
point où les données nouvelles s'achèvent. Si un excès de
données est envoyé, les données supplémentaires sont
ignorées. Cette commande ne peut pas être utilisée pour
l'interface RS232 à cause du bloc de données binaires.

Publicité

loading